We store 2 things via the "basement" interior door: our small electric heater when not in use, and the laundry bag. When the bag gets relatively full on a long trip, we move it to the truck and get out a new bag. Perfect spot for that purpose. -

If you're in the Cape Canaveral area, the Merritt Island National Wildlife Refuge is worth a visit: drive down the Black Point Wildlife Drive for birding. Someone we met there also recommended the Orlando Wetlands Park which is run by the city of Orlando but is east of there near Fort Christmas , across the road from Christmas, FL. This was a great spot as well.

We decided not to get the mattress upgrade for several reasons: - We live close to the Southern Mattress factory so we could add them later. It made sense to go ahead and get what was already included in the base price. -When I sat in a sample Ollie at the factory that had a mattress, for me it was less comfortable for sitting on during the daytime because my feet were at a different angle on the floor. Does that make sense? It was too high, even though I'm a 5'7" female. --The mattresses are heavy. If you use the provided cushions, it's easier to lift them up and access under the beds if needed. We also sometimes remove the cushions and bring them in the house in humid summer NC weather. We are very happy with our decision. I sleep great on just the cushions and my husband added a foam topper on his side.
